What is the function of pain management?

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=

Pain management refers to the medical practice of alleviating or controlling pain experienced by patients. The function of pain management is to improve the quality of life for individuals suffering from acute or chronic pain conditions.

The goal of pain management is to provide relief from pain, allowing patients to engage in daily activities, recover from injuries, and perform routine tasks without experiencing excessive discomfort. Pain management techniques can include both pharmacological and non-pharmacological approaches.

Pharmacological interventions commonly used in pain management include analgesic medications such as n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s), opioids, and anticonvulsants. These medications aim to reduce pain and promote comfort by targeting the underlying mechanisms of pain transmission in the body. However, it is essential to carefully administer these drugs due to potential side effects and risks of dependency.

Non-pharmacological approaches used in pain management involve various techniques that do not rely on medication. These methods can include physical therapy, exercise, acupuncture, massage therapy, and psychological interventions. These approaches seek to alleviate pain by promoting relaxation, enhancing mobility, increasing strength, and reducing stress and anxiety.

Pain management also involves an interdisciplinary approach, where healthcare professionals from diverse fields collaborate to develop a comprehensive treatment plan tailored to each patient’s unique needs. This multidisciplinary team may include physicians, nurses, physiotherapists, psychologists, and occupational therapists.

In addition to providing treatment, pain management also focuses on educating patients regarding their pain condition, self-management techniques, and potential treatment options. This empowers individuals to actively participate in their own pain management and make informed choices regarding their healthcare.

In conclusion, the function of pain management is to alleviate pain, improve functionality, and enhance the quality of life for patients experiencing acute or chronic pain. It involves a combination of pharmacological and non-pharmacological interventions and requires a multidisciplinary approach to ensure personalized care for each individual experiencing pain.

What is a functional goal for pain management?

A function-based treatment strategy measures a patient’s progress not in pain relief, but in his or her ability to function better in life. Functional goals would include sleeping, walking, working, connecting with friends, etc.

What is the main goal of pain management?

The first and most major pain management goal is pain control and relief while taking the lowest dose of medications possible. Meaningful pain relief has been proven to improve functionality and quality of life.

Why are pain clinics important?

It’s to cut your pain and raise your quality of life. Treatment at a pain clinic can give you the skills to manage your chronic pain on your own and make you more able to function, possibly so that you may return to work.
